Good value additional storage for a vehicle
I recently bought two reclining loungers for our holidays and bought this to transport them.An additional non slip mat is required.It comfortably held the two recliners, two folding chairs a folding table and assorted paraphernalia including a small set of steps to make installing, loading and unloading easier for me.Our car has built in rails so fitting the bag was a doddle. It does come with additional straps and can be used on vehicle without rails. It appears to be robustly constructed of a weatherproof material. The weakness for water ingress would be the zips but they are both substancial and well protected with a flap that when folded over the zip should keep out most moisture. Our trip was dry in both directions so I cannot say whether that aspect worked in practice.Some thought needs to be given to packing things into the bag so that it keeps a reasonable shape when loaded.Our trip was just over 200 miles on mixed roads including motorways and the bag remained firmly in place throughout.All in all I am very happ with the purchase and would recommend it to anyone wanting cost effective additional storage for their vehicle.

Great in driving rain! Bone dry contents!
Fits our Honda FRV fine, works brilliantly with roof bars, and very secure once atrached to the bars. We drove from Kent to Ilfracombe in pouring rain and all the items packed were bone dry on arrival. Same on the way home, it rained and everything was dry! That's all we wanted.We took care to ensure the footprint was about right for our roof. It fitted easily between the roof bars and takes up about 75% of the length.I think the trick is to pack it with soft stuff, so on our camping trip we packed the SIMs, duvets, pillows, tarp, tent carpet, clothes in a soft holdall, swimming gear, towels, floor mats, some food items that wouldn't squash in bags for life, and trainers/soft shoes/flip flops etc, again in a bag for life. We avoided metal and anything with sharp edges so no crates or boxes. Also helps if it is packed tight and full, as then there are less dips for water to collect if it rains.We did padlock ours shut (helps if it's well packed so harder to unzip when padlocked as well) and made sure when parked in services we were near the entrance and we didn't put anything super valuable in the top. All the tents etc went inside the car!The great thing is you can take it off and leave it in the tent or boot when not in use on a holiday, and ours is in a bag in the loft between uses, rather than having a big roof box to deal with and store.I'd definitely recommend this.
